00054 /*
00055  * we need to distinguish between a token
00056  * created by us using get_mic vs one using
00057  * the SSL application data
00058  * We use this in wrap and unwrap
00059  * Future versions of SSL may use this
00060  *
00061  * Our wrapped buffer (integrity only) has
00062  *
00063  *  byte  type[1]          = SSL3_RT_GSSAPI_OPENSSL
00064  *  byte  version_major[1] = 0x03
00065  *  byte  version_minor[1] = 0
00066  *  byte  mic_length[2]    = 2 byte length of following mic 
00067  * 
00068  *  byte  mic_seq[8]           = 8 byte sequence number
00069  *  byte  mic_data_length[4]   = 4 byte length of data 
00070  *  byte  hash[*]          = the hash of variable length
00071  *
00072  *  byte  data[*]          = the data being wrapped. 
00073  */
00074 
00075 #define SSL3_RT_GSSAPI_OPENSSL                   26
